Overview

Skello is a SaaS platform that helps businesses manage their workforce, including scheduling, time and absence tracking, payroll, and HR tasks. Managers create shift schedules, assign employees, and share updates, while staff can view and swap shifts, request time off, and log hours via web or mobile apps; payroll and HR data are automatically aligned with scheduling data. It stands out by targeting complex, shift-based needs in industries like restaurants, retail, and healthcare, with a collaborative and user-friendly interface for large numbers of part-time workers. Its goal is to help businesses run their workforce more efficiently and accurately so they can focus on serving customers.

Series B funding is typically for startups that have proven their business model and need more funding to expand rapidly—often by entering new markets or adding more products. Investors are usually venture capital firms that specialize in later-stage investments.
